Yes, topiramate and semaglutide can be used together, but this combination requires close medical supervision due to overlapping mechanisms and potential drug interactions. Both medications affect appetite signaling and metabolic pathways, making individual assessment critical before co-prescribing.

How Topiramate and Semaglutide Work Together at the Metabolic Level

Topiramate is an anticonvulsant that may enhance weight loss through appetite suppression and increased satiety signaling, independent of GLP-1 receptor activation. Semaglutide works directly on GLP-1 receptors to slow gastric emptying and reduce hunger hormones, creating synergistic but distinct mechanisms.

When combined, these medications may produce additive appetite reduction and improved glucose control, but also increase the risk of gastrointestinal side effects, dehydration, and metabolic dysregulation. Clinical evidence supports combination use in select patients, though data on long-term safety remains limited compared to monotherapy.

Drug Interaction Profile and Clinical Monitoring Requirements

Topiramate does not undergo significant CYP450 metabolism, reducing direct pharmacokinetic interactions with semaglutide. However, both drugs independently reduce appetite and fluid intake, creating an additive risk for dehydration, electrolyte imbalances, and acute kidney injury in vulnerable populations.

Interaction Factor Clinical Significance
Direct CYP450 Overlap Minimal; no major pharmacokinetic interaction expected
Gastrointestinal Effects Additive nausea, vomiting, constipation; increased risk of pancreatitis
Hydration & Electrolytes Both reduce fluid intake; monitor sodium, potassium, kidney function
Cognitive/CNS Effects Topiramate may cause word-finding difficulty; semaglutide does not; monitor baseline cognition
Monitoring Frequency Baseline labs + follow-up at 2-4 weeks, 8 weeks, then quarterly

Patient Populations Where Combination Therapy May Be Appropriate

Combination topiramate-semaglutide may be considered in obese patients with concurrent migraines, epilepsy, or mood disorders where topiramate provides dual therapeutic benefit. Patients with type 2 diabetes and poor glycemic control on semaglutide monotherapy may also benefit, though evidence remains observational.

Conversely, patients with history of acute kidney injury, severe dehydration, pancreatitis, or cognitive concerns should avoid this combination or pursue it only under intensive monitoring. Older adults and those on concurrent diuretics face elevated risk and require baseline renal function assessment before initiation.

Safety Considerations and When to Seek Provider Guidance

Red flags during combination therapy include persistent vomiting, severe abdominal pain, dizziness, acute confusion, dark urine, or signs of pancreatitis. Any of these warrant immediate medical evaluation and possible dose adjustment or discontinuation of one or both agents.

A qualified healthcare provider should assess your renal function, baseline hydration status, electrolyte levels, and medication history before prescribing this combination. Regular follow-up labs and symptom checks every 4-8 weeks help detect emerging problems early and optimize dosing for your individual metabolic response.
